They&amp;rsquo;re designed for those moments when you need high-output heat, and you need it &lt;em&gt;now&lt;/em&gt;.&#xA;&lt;strong&gt;The power behind the size&lt;/strong&gt;&#xA;These lamps are 980mm long, which is a pretty standard fit for most medium-to-large setups. But here&amp;rsquo;s the real kicker: we&amp;rsquo;re pushing 2000W through that length.&#xA;That creates a massive amount of heat in a very concentrated zone. It hits your target temperature way faster than the lower-wattage stuff. Just a heads-up, though—this is a lot of power. Double-check your wiring and power supply. You don&amp;rsquo;t want your terminals overheating because the current is too heavy for your cables.&#xA;&lt;strong&gt;How they&amp;rsquo;re actually built&lt;/strong&gt;&#xA;Inside the high-purity quartz glass, we use a halogen cycle. Basically, the gas stops the tungsten from evaporating and clouding up the glass.&#xA;It keeps the light clear and the heat steady for the entire life of the lamp. Plus, these are simple drop-in replacements. You won&amp;rsquo;t have to mess around with your machine frame or modify your sockets; they just fit.&#xA;&lt;strong&gt;Where they work (and what to watch out for)&lt;/strong&gt;&#xA;You&amp;rsquo;ll &lt;a href=&#34;https://o-yate.net&#34;&gt;usually&lt;/a&gt; see these in PET blowing machines, textile drying, or automotive paint curing. The shortwave &lt;a href=&#34;https://o-yate.com&#34;&gt;radiation&lt;/a&gt; just cuts right through the material surface.&#xA;But there are a few things that can trip you up.&#xA;First, 2000W is intense. If your reflectors are dirty or pitted, you&amp;rsquo;re basically throwing energy away.&#xA;Then there&amp;rsquo;s the airflow. Make sure your cooling fans are actually doing their job. If the ends of the lamp get too hot, the quartz will just give out.&#xA;And for the love of everything,&lt;strong&gt;keep the glass clean&lt;/strong&gt;. A single fingerprint or a smudge of oil creates a hot spot. If that happens, the tube will burn out almost instantly. Keep them spotless, and they&amp;rsquo;ll treat you right.&lt;/p&gt;</description>
